  • Corian kitchen worktops: A material that can be used in a host of different ways, Corian kitchen worktops are a favourite with kitchen designers. It uses an advanced blend of acrylic polymer and natural minerals and it has a hygienic, non-porous surface with a host of colours available.
  • Granite kitchen worktops: With a classic look, granite kitchen worktops remain hugely popular. Premium grade granite should be naturally sealed and highly polished with an even distribution of natural fleck within the stone.
  • Silestone kitchen worktops: Silestone kitchen worktops are made from 94 per cent quartz and have anti-bacterial protection that means it is arguably more hygienic than any other type of surface. It is also available in a number of colours so it should look ideal in any home.
  • Zodiaq kitchen worktops: Zodiaq kitchen worktops are made from 93 per cent quartz and have exceptional strength meaning they could be a real long-term investment for your home. They are also available in a host of colours ranging from pastel colours to black.
